Experts in clinical research and operations in China say the Ministry of Health’s new Good Supply Practice (GSP) regulations means local pharmaceutical companies need to lift their game when storing and handling medical goods or they risk getting left behind.Charlie Xu, Vice President for Clinical Operations at Frontage Lab China said that compared to multinational companies, many local players don’t have stringent compliance records and the regulations are intended to raise the standards of GSP...
